Binary packages built by this source
- librust-dirs-next-dev: Tiny low-level library that provides platform-specific standard locations of directories for config, cache and other data on Linux, Windows, macOS and Redox by leveraging the mechanisms defined by the XDG base/user directory specifications on Linux, the Known Folder API on Windows, and the Standard Directory guidelines on macOS - Rust source code
This package contains the source for the Rust dirs-next crate, packaged by
debcargo for use with cargo and dh-cargo.
